Affirm Holdings, Inc. operates a platform for digital and mobile commerce in the United States and Canada. The company is headquartered in San Francisco, California.

Credit Acceptance Corporation offers financing programs and related products and services to independent and franchised automobile dealerships in the United States. The company is headquartered in Southfield, Michigan.
